Jerry Wesley Moran is an American politician serving as the senior United States senator from Kansas since January 3, 2011. A member of the Republican Party, Moran has focused on various issues during his tenure, including veterans' affairs, agriculture, and economic development. He has been an advocate for ensuring veterans have access to quality healthcare and has worked on legislation to improve the services provided by the Department of Veterans Affairs.
